What Are Binance Trading Bots?
Binance trading bots are automated programs that execute trades on your behalf based on predefined strategies. Key benefits include:
- 24/7 market participation without manual oversight
- Faster trade execution than human traders
- Elimination of emotional decision-making
- Continuous exploitation of market opportunities

Popular Binance Trading Bot Types
1. Spot Grid Bot
- Operates in spot markets
- Places buy-low/sell-high orders within set price ranges
- Profits from market volatility without predicting direction
2. Futures Grid Bot
- Similar to Spot Grid but uses leveraged contracts
- Enables short positions without holding assets
- Suitable for experienced traders only
3. Arbitrage Bot
- Exploits price differences between markets
Common strategies:
- Negative funding rate: Long futures + spot sell
- Positive funding rate: Short futures + spot buy
4. Smart Rebalancing
- Maintains target asset allocations automatically
- Example: Keeps BTC at 45% of portfolio by rebalancing during price swings
5. Spot DCA (Dollar-Cost Averaging)
- Spreads purchases over time to reduce volatility impact
- Buys more when prices drop, sells gradually during rallies
6. Recurring Investments
- Automated periodic purchases for long-term accumulation
- Customizable by asset and investment timeframe

Pro Tips for Effective Bot Usage
Configuration Best Practices
- Start small - Test with minimal funds first
- Set clear goals - Define profit targets and risk tolerance
- Optimize parameters - Adjust price ranges and grid levels regularly
- Implement risk management - Use stop-loss/take-profit orders
- Diversify strategies - Don't rely on a single bot type
Performance Monitoring
- Track key metrics: P/L, trade frequency, win rate
- Stay updated on market news affecting your strategy
- Be ready to adjust settings as conditions change
FAQ Section
Q: Are trading bots safe to use?
A: While Binance bots are reliable, all trading carries risk. Never invest more than you can afford to lose.
Q: How much capital do I need to start?
A: Many bots work with small amounts (e.g., $50-$100), but sufficient capital improves strategy effectiveness.
Q: Can bots guarantee profits?
A: No—market conditions change, and past performance doesn't guarantee future results. Proper configuration and monitoring are essential.
Q: Which bot is best for beginners?
A: Spot DCA and Recurring Investments are excellent starting points due to their simplicity.
